What Does "g" or "gm" Really Mean?

So, how is a gram represented in abbreviation? You might be surprised to find that it’s pretty straightforward. The gram is commonly abbreviated as either "g" or "gm". Now, if you’re wondering why we have two abbreviations, let’s clarify: while "g" is the more widely accepted abbreviation, "gm" is an alternative that some may still recognize—though you won’t see it as often in modern contexts, especially when it comes to medication.

Other Abbreviations You Might Encounter

Now, before we move along, it’s important to understand what the other options on that practice test are, just to avoid any confusion:

  • "gr." refers to grains, a unit that’s largely fallen out of favor in modern medicine, especially in medication dosages. Ever tried to calculate a grain dosage? It can be tricky!
  • "cc" stands for cubic centimeters. This volume measurement is primarily used for liquid medications. You’ll see it a lot in syringes and IVs. Think of it like measuring water to fill a bottle.
  • "gtt." represents drops and is commonly used for medications that must be administered in small liquid doses, like eye drops or some liquid medications.
